Mid-year renewals may see new drivers and demand boost, no jolt to trend

The mid-year reinsurance renewals, with their US property cat focus, may yet see the market’s seemingly ever-rising capacity face a boost on the demand side as US cedant buying trends, structural changes in the key Florida market and a whiff of global turmoil could bring hints of long-lost demand factors back into the equation, leading re/insurance brokerages suggest of the cards now being dealt.
